    <description>The SC and HC precedents guided the Tribunal&#039;s ruling on service tax for a university. The Tribunal held that affiliation fees and rental income from campus facilities are exempt under section 66D(1) of the Finance Act, 1994. Relying on prior judicial decisions, the Tribunal set aside the service tax demand, interest, and penalties, affirming the educational institution&#039;s tax exemption.</description>
